I am new to CKeditor, and am finding it difficult to implement CKeditor on an ASP.NET MVC5 site. I added the standard version of CKeditor to the development site in VS2013 using Nuget. I added the js files in a script bundle, and a view with a textarea. I have added jQuery and the jQuery adadptor, but putting a script of $("#mytextarea").ckeditor() does not work. I can get CKeditor working in VS2013 by adding the class ckeditor to the textarea. But when I uploaded the files to the production server, the textarea is not recognized as CKeditor.
I assume that I have not copied something important, but not sure what. I have uploaded the script files, views, applicaction binary and web.config files. I have tried explicitly adding a script for initiating CKeditor as per the Basic setup with CKEDITOR.replace('FollowUp'); but this makes no difference

Problem sorted
The problem seems to be that I used a script bundle to add the js files. For me the simplest solution was to add the js files manually with <script src="@Url.Content("~/Scripts/ckeditor/ckeditor.js")"></script>
<script src="@Url.Content("~/Scripts/ckeditor//adapters/jquery.js")"></script>
I think I could also have specified the Editor Basepath .
